1. Purpose
To ensure that all Framework related documentation for the project is handed over to “The Client” (TPL) in a timeous and controlled manner.
The activities in this procedure form part of the final Handover and Closeout Plan.
2. Scope
This Procedure describes the process and system activities required to prepare, collate and issue all identified and agreed documentation that fulfils the Framework Requirements during the handover period at completion of the Island View and Jameson Park Terminals for the New Multi-Product Pipeline Project. The inclusion of references to other assets on the NMPP Project is for the sake of completeness and potential cross referencing.
Handover includes the following:
Handover from the Contractor/Vendor/Supplier/Consultant - to - TCP
Turnover from TCP - to - TPL
3. Terminology / Definitions
24” MPP 24” Multi-Product Pipeline (Trunkline)
AFC Approved for Construction
AIA Authorised Inspection Authority
As-Built (AB) This is a final record of what was actually installed/constructed according to the Fabrication/Construction Contractor and includes all deviations or changes from the approved IFC/IFU document(s). As-Built documentation is required to reflect the same degree of detail as the original documentation.
Aconex Electronic Document Management System – EDMS (Electronic Document Management System utilised by the Pipelines Project)
AWP Arup/WorleyParsons Joint Venture
BO Beneficial Operation
CAD Computer Aided Design / Drawing
CCMS Construction and Completions Management System
Client Transnet Pipelines (TPL)
CoC Certificate of Conformance
Commissioning Commissioning activities (deemed to be potentially hazardous) comprises of actions required to prepare the equipment and facilities for the first introduction of feed stocks for production / storage / transport purposes
Completion Completion (Project) is the final milestone when the supporting documentation / documentation in terms of this procedure is handed over to the Client (TPL) and thereby concluding TCP’s commitments to the Client.
Data Book Dossier containing evidence of contractual compliance and performance in terms of the requirements of this procedure for equipment supply contracts
Data Pack Dossier containing evidence of contractual compliance and performance in terms of the requirements of this procedure for erection and installation contracts

6.9 Construction Completion Requirements
The construction completion milestone (at MC) is generally an internal project (per Asset) milestone with respect to documents. The documents are required at MC to allow Pre-commissioning to complete the Pre-commissioning performance & tests and have documents compiled for them in readiness for the RFC milestone.
Refer to: 2684358-P-A00-CO-PH-002 TM1 & TM2 Facilities - Construction, Completion, Handover & Turnover
6.9.1 Requirements for MC are as follows:
Classification of Documents
Mechanical Completion Requirements (Refer to Annexure D for detailed document requirements)
Red-Lined (All documents listed “Y” in Document Handover Matrix)
Paper sets of documents as per the separable portion document lists, to be submitted to document control. Each document shall be signed off as complete by the contractor and Designer. Document status shall be “As-Built Construction”
Mandatory Documents (All documents listed “M” in Document Handover Matrix)
Documents shall be in document control to A-Approval status and available to the TCP in electronic form.
Planned Documents (All documents listed “I” in Document Handover Matrix)
Documents must be available in the form specified in Document Handover Matrix for inspection if requested. The components for this document type shall be completed to the equivalent state of the equipment to which documents are associated with.
Certificates of Compliance
Any certificates of compliance or certification of lifting equipment pressure vessels, electrical, or gas systems are to be provided to Field Engineering where originals shall be stored in a secure location e.g. Asset Control Room.
TCP Certificates
Take-over certificates / Material Received Report issued to Vendors Copies of CC/MC completion certificates: - Civil & Structural (PC) - Mechanical & Piping (M&P) - Electrical (EC) - Instrumentation & Control (IC) Practical Completion sign-off by TPL

6.11 Quality
The quality of documents shall comply to project standards as well as the specific points listed below.
Specific PDF requirements are as follows:
i. Page creation sizes shall match the original drawing or Document size – to enable full size printing from the PDF, particularly for scale drawings.
ii. All pages in the PDF shall be orientated to match the original orientation to able reading without having to rotate any pages.
iii. PDF files shall have no security set
iv. Clear book marking shall be used to aid navigation through the document
v. Where signatures are required – a scan of the signature page will replace the electronically produced page.
vi. Scanning of documents shall be done at a minimum of 250 DPI. Printing of the scanned document shall be capable of reproducing the original document without significant loss of image quality and shall have a clear background.
vii. All PDF’s shall be saved to be compatible with Adobe reader 7 or higher.
viii. Opening options should be set to default to view ‘full page’ & ‘bookmarks’ if present
ix. PDF file sizes should be reduced using the Adobe Optimization function.
6.12 As-Built Redline Mark Ups
As-Built mark ups are handed over by System. Each document shall have all field changes marked up on a single version of the drawing for each System. Handover of a successive System shall include the mark ups from previous System handovers. Any cross contract mark ups shall be combined onto a single document before pre commissioning mark ups are started. The responsibility of combining of drawings shall reside with the Designer.
Each document shall be stamped on the front of the drawing with an “AS-BUILT” stamp, indicating System, date, signature of contractor and acceptance by TCP.
Drawing size shall generally be A4 for word type documents and A3 for drawing type documents but the legibility of the document must be such that further copies shall remain legible. If it is not possible at that size, then larger versions shall be submitted
6.13 “Wet” Signature Documentation
After completion and final submission of as-built documentation, which includes undergoing final Project review/acceptance by means of “wet” signatures, the documentation shall be scanned to PDF file format and uploaded into Aconex. A copy shall be included in the ‘hand over packs’ by replacing previous revisions with the final ‘as-built status’.
All the final revision “wet” signature deliverable documentation (i.e. “As-Built, Final and / or For Record”) as prepared and updated by the Project and / or External Parties, shall be

6.14 CAD Drawing Files (Source Files)
AutoCAD ‘native’ drawings shall be checked by Engineering to confirm drawings are back to back with formal ‘wet’ signature drawings
One electronic native file per drawing shall be provided. Where not in DWG format, the file shall be at least a native export DXF file or compatible per drawing.
The AutoCAD file shall include all reference files merged, including standard title blocks,
borders etc. (i.e. bound file) and not flat lined.
6.15 Internal Design Documentation
History Files, Master Mark Up files and Contractor History files (inclusive of reviews and checking) shall be maintained by TCP Portfolio Manager Technical and shall not be handed over but will be archived.
The Master Mark-up files shall be compiled from the Master File maintained in the Site Management Offices.
A copy of the Master File may be placed in the Asset Control Room under the direction of TPL.

Master Electrical CoC documentation for handover to TPL shall have the following contents:
1. Reports / Certificates:
(a) Dept. of Labour CoC and SANS 10142-1 test report
(b) SANS 10142-2:2009 - MV Installation Safety Report. Installations where: 1000V < VAC < 33 kV
(c) Responsibility definition sheet – This is required if the Design section of the Government ticket requires more than one signature ( eg. E & I portions ), or alternatively if the Responsible Person is only liable for certain parts of the design covered by the CoC. This can be specified here.
(d) Hazardous Area Drawing (Plan & Elevation), Hazardous Area classification drawing and Section 3 Additional Hazardous Area check sheet where applicable.
2. Field / Construction Documentation:
2.1 Electrical
(a) Cable Megger Test Sheet(s)
(b) Megger Test for Motor – Where Applicable
(c) Equipment Earthing and Bonding Test Sheet
(d) Volt drop per cable
(e) Checkout List(s)
(f) SANS 10086-1 inspection sheet for EXi, EXd, Exe & EXn rated equipment
(g) Hi-Potential testing certificate – any cable with operating voltage above 1000 VAC
(h) For All distribution boards :
(i) Lighting & Small Power Layout drawing
(ii) Circuit test certificate showing that each circuit has been traced and successfully tested
(iii) DB Single line diagram
(i) Cable Schedule
(j) Connection Diagram
(k) Overall Single Line
(l) Earth spike readings per area with a reference to Earthing layout drawing
2.2 Instrumentation
